Households' assets in life insurance reached USD 2,466 bil in 2022 in Japan, according to OECD. This is 15.8% less than in the previous year.
Historically, households' assets in life insurance in Japan reached an all time high of USD 3,675 bil in 2012 and an all time low of USD 1,933 bil in 1998.
Japan has been ranked 2nd within the group of 30 countries we follow in terms of households' assets in life insurance.
